We would like to invite you to a new office of VTB Bank (Kazakhstan) in Kokshetau city

09.12.2014 A new office of VTB Bank (Kazakhstan) of “easy” format in Kokshetau city is located in the city business center at the address: 143, Abai Str. This is the second office of the Bank in Kokshetau city – the Bank’s Branch was opened here in August 2011.

Marlen Mukhamedzhanov, Director of Kokshetau city Branch of VTB Bank (Kazakhstan) JSC SO, said, “In “easy” format offices the Bank’s managers will provide the customers with information about the bank products and services in the conditions most comfortable for them. Everyone will be able to choose an individual offer on loans, deposits, payments cards and transfers of our Bank. Since there are no cash departments in the new office, the customers will perform any cash transactions through ATM with cash-in and cash-out functions. ”

A new format of bank servicing without use of the conventional cash departments will make it possible to provide high level of accessibility to the Bank’s products and services. M. Mukhamedzhanov noted, “The office of “easy” format will allow re-distributing the customers flows and reducing time to obtain the required services due to decrease of queues in the Bank’s Branch and immediate receipt of similar services in the network of “easy” format.”

Market representation in cities of Kazakhstan will provide an opportunity for VTB Bank (Kazakhstan) to become closer to the customers and to increase accessibility and promptness of bank services and products receipt.

For reference:
VTB Bank (Kazakhstan) JSC SO is 100% subsidiary Bank of the largest Russian VTB Bank OJSC.
The License of the National Bank of the RK No 1.2.14/39 dated 06.10.2014.
The Bank was assigned the international rating at BB+/Negative outlook by the Standard & Poor’s Agency. VTB Bank and its subsidiaries form the international financial group keeping its activities at Russian and foreign markets. VTB Group consists of more than 30 banks and financial companies in 20 countries of the CIS, Europe, Asia and Africa. The major shareholders of VTB is the Government of the Russian Federation (60,9%).
